The Seduction and Peril of Sleep Aids
For many fighting with insomnia, the allure of sleeping pills is undeniable. Guaranties of a full night's rest, free from tossing and turning, can be incredibly tempting when you're exhausted. However, this seemingly harmless solution often comes with unseen dangers that can ensnare you in a vicious cycle. While they may provide temporary respite, long-term use of sleeping pills can alter your natural sleep patterns, leading to dependence. The body gets used to the artificial aid, making it increasingly difficult to fall asleep without them. This can result in a worsening of insomnia, creating a deceptive cycle that keeps you trapped.
